DUMFRIES and Galloway Council is set to ask the UK Government to halt plans to privatise Royal Mail over fears it will lead to more rural post office closures.

A majority of councillors backed a motion by the authority’s Labour group to “keep the Post Office public” at a meeting on Thursday.

But before they narrowly won a vote 18-17 to write to the UK Government, Labour councillors faced criticism over the actions of the previous Labour Government.

Lib Dem councillor Richard Brodie said: “This comes from the party which wielded a deadly axe on hundreds of post offices including rural areas.

“The past Government knew the problem but failed to take any action.”

Conservative councillor John Charteris said: “This motion is the hallmark of a party which is in complete denial.”

The Business Secretary Vince Cable recently announced details of the Postal Services Bill which is designed to pave the way for the privatisation of Royal Mail.

Currently the Post Office is wholly owned by Royal Mail but the two will be separated as a result of the bill.

Labour councillor Jeff Leaver who proposed the motion said those plans will mean cuts to post offices in rural areas.

Labour and SNP members voted for the motion while Lib Dems and Tories voted against it.
